@Izzy_Havoc Жыл бұрын
did you have to use an ls4? how much space does it save?
@highcalaber Жыл бұрын
Yes, I had an issue with the timing cover I went over this in a video. I was able to use the LS4 water manifold to save a lot of space. The LS4 crank pulley was also pretty much the only pulley that I could use. But other than that it's not much different than any other LS aside from the bolt pattern, but I wasn't using a transmission that had a compatible pattern anyways.

@parkerbethke Жыл бұрын
How come you dont just move the transmission and transfercase back several inches and get new front and rear driveshafts? Wouldnt that have made the whole swap easier, considering the engine wouldnt essentially be hanging out the front of the car? Amazing work by the way, dream build.
@highcalaber Жыл бұрын
There is no transfer case, the front differential is part of the transmission. I could've moved it back, it may have been a good choice.
